Why Kids Can't Read

But today, after seeing this story on an NPR website, I finally understand the real problem: American kids can't read any more. Now, this was a radio program, so it was audio. I dreaded having to listen to the whole thing. Audio has all the same problems as video: you can't skim or search it. But I just wanted to find out actual reason for why kids these days can't read.

Fortunately for me, the script of the radio program was included, so I could skip to the important part. And the reason kids can't read today is that reading teachers don't teach phonics. That is, they don't dwell on the fact that the letters of the English alphabet have a phonetic correspondence to the sounds you make when you speak.

In the last few decades most reading teachers have used a touchy-feely "whole language" approach, rather than what they considered the staid and rote phonetic method.

But writing systems, for most part, are phonetic. That is, they encode sounds as symbols, which you decode by pronouncing the sounds the symbols represent.

Not all writing systems work this way. Chinese and Japanese use pictograms or ideographs to represent words. Japanese actually has three writing systems: two are phonetic syllabaries (katakana and hiragana), and one is ideographic (kanji).

Proponents of whole language aren't completely off base. As readers of English become more adroit the phonetic component of writing becomes less important. They start to recognize entire words and the sounds never enter their minds. Reading in this sophisticated fashion allows people to read at hundreds of words per minute, and some people can read even faster than that.

At this point a written word becomes a concept, like a Chinese pictogram.

It is this realization, I believe, that convinced educators (incorrectly) back in the day that phonics were unnecessary, boring and detrimental. They thought they could let kids skip the tedious part of reading -- converting symbols to sounds -- and progress directly to the sophisticated method that the most adept readers use.

Contributing to the denigration of phonics is the fact that English doesn't have a truly phonetic writing system. It's a Germanic language that has been infiltrated by thousands of French, Latin and Greek words over a millennium.

Also, the pronunciations of native English words have changed drastically over the centuries, so that the spellings of many words have little to do with the current pronunciations: enough, through, friend, four, says, etc.

Foreign loan words from French, Latin and Greek have their own pronunciation rules, and even grammatical rules, such as for plurals: alumnus -- alumni, millennium -- millennia, crisis -- crises, and so on.

Other languages don't have this problem to the same degree as English. The vast majority of European languages (German, Italian, Spanish, Russian, Czech, Polish, etc.), are much more phonetic than English. They use different -- though consistent -- sets of rules for pronunciation, which makes Americans think those languages aren't phonetic.

I have studied several other languages (German, Russian, French, Japanese) and the only way for me to grasp them was to learn the phonology of the languages and the intrinsic link to their writing systems (with Japanese, it's the kana, not the kanji).

I can read German, French and Russian with a fair degree of fluency, but I'm totally lost with Japanese. I didn't study it as long, and I didn't learn the kanji so I'm totally illiterate in the language. The problem is that there are tens of thousands of kanji, and there are no shortcuts for learning them. You have to memorize them all by rote. When I realized that, I gave up on Japanese: TLDR. (I've also forgotten most of the kana: there are more than 140.)

Memorizing kanji takes years and years. Worse, if you don't use them on a daily basis, you immediately start forgetting them. My wife's Japanese teacher had lived in the United States for decades and had forgotten the lesser-used kanji. A highly educated Japanese-born professor had devolved to a high-school level reading vocabulary.

The crazy thing is that he still knows the words those kanji represent: he just can't read them or write the kanji anymore. He can still spell the words out with kana -- he'll just look illiterate if anyone else sees what he's written.

This is why the "whole language" approach for teaching kids to read has failed. Yes, advanced readers can instantly link a sequence of characters to a word without sounding out the letters. But only after seeing it over and over, the same way a Japanese person learns kanji.

There are thousands upon thousands of common English words: too many for kids to memorize. It's far easier to learn the 26 letters of the English alphabet and several dozen pronunciation rules, and several more dozen exceptions to those rules.

And phonics works. According to the APM story, after teachers in Bethlehem, PA received training in the science of reading (basically, phonics), the reading proficiency of their students doubled within two years.

Once kids learn the basic rules they can decode most any text. They may not know the exact meaning of every word right off the bat, but nine times out of ten they'll be able to get the gist of mystery words from context.

And unlike the characterization some whole language proponents have hit phonics with, it isn't just a rote method: it is a problem-solving technique. It teaches kids how to break down a problem (a written word) into its component parts (the letters) and come up with an answer (the pronunciation).

This isn't the first time this "reading war" has flared up. In the 1950s a teacher named Rudolf Flesch found a 12-year-old boy who couldn't even sound out the word "kid." This prompted him to write the book Why Johnny Can't Read.

The book inspired Theodore Geisel to write The Cat in the Hat, proving that books using the principles of phonics don't have to be boring.
